Gravitee.io in London is looking for a skilled strategic finance operator to enhance finance workflows through AI and automation. This individual contributor position collaborates closely with Finance leadership and engineering teams to innovate a scalable finance function.

Successful candidates will have strong FP&A experience and will actively lead the design and implementation of finance systems. If you are passionate about finance transformation and automation, this could be the perfect role for you.
